Eligible after ban
Richarlison is in contention to play again after his suspension in Wednesday's UEFA Champions League meeting with Atletico Madrid.
Analysis: Richarlison will compete with Dominic Solanke and Wednesday's scorer Randal Kolo Muani for starts in the next Premier League fixtures. Before missing the Spurs' last Champions League game of the season, Richarlison notched two goals and one assist over his last four official appearances, and he could remain a decent threat if given meaningful time on the field.
Picks up ban
Richarlison is suspended for Wednesday's second leg against Atletico due to yellow card accumulation, according to UEFA.
Analysis: Richarlison will hit the sidelines for the club's second leg of their knockout contest against Atletico, suspended after a third yellow in the competition. This is a blow for the Spurs since he started in the last two games under new coach Igor Tudor and his absence will therefore force a change in the front line, with Randal Kolo Muani and Dominic Solanke likely getting larger roles against the Colchoneros.
